Abstract:The softening behavior of a low carbon and high-Nb x80 pipeline steel with different Cr contents under the same deformation conditions has been studied by using a Gleeble-1500D thermomechanical simulator. The static recrystallized fraction was calculated by the offset method,and the influence of temperature and interval time was analyzed. The results show that when the deformation temperature is between 900℃ and 980℃,and when the content of Cr reaches a certain level, there exists a strong effect to solid solubility of NbC of Cr, which can inhibit the static recrystallization of austenite;Futhermore,The addition of Cr can increase the solubility of NbC、decrease the driving force and therefore delay the time of precipitation.
